Neon Flower Nails
Supplies
  • White nail polish
  • Various neon nail polishes
  • Silver nail polish
  • Base/top coat
  • toothpick
clear coat Step 1 Apply a quality base coat (OPI, China Glaze, Revlon, Essie...) to all of your nails. I'm using a Revlon base coat. This is essential to protecting your nails from staining. Make sure your nails are fully dry before proceeding.


french tip Step 2 Using your white polish and the regular brush paint french tips on all your nails. I'm using 023 White On White by China Glaze.




blue coat Step 3 Choose your neon colors. You need at least 3 and no more than 6 because you want the nails to have some repetition. I went with 5 different colors: a purple, NP423 Phenomena by L.A. Colors; a blue, 4860-04 Blue Me Away! by Sally Hansen Xtreme Wear ; a lime green, 4860-02 Green With Envy by Sally Hansen Xtreme Wear; an orange, 4860A0 Mandarin by Sally Hansen Xtreme Wear; and a pink, 220 Bubble by Revlon Top Speed. Using a dotting tool, either home made or store bought, dip into a color and draw flowers by placing five dots together to create a flower. Draw three flowers on each nail varying the color combinations and order of placement every time. If you don't already have a dotting tool, you can unbend a bobby pin and use the rubber tip.
silver centered flowers Step 4 Use your dotting tool or a toothpick into silver polish to create the flower centers.
silver centered flowers Step 5 Finish off with a top coat. Voila! Enjoy your colorful, fun nails.
